Massachusetts homes face a range of weather conditions that necessitate robust roofing. Coastal areas are susceptible to salt spray and strong winds, while inland regions experience heavy snowfall and ice dams in winter. Summer heat and humidity can also contribute to shingle degradation. For homes in Boston, Brockton, Lynn, and Lawrence, choosing durable shingle types is essential. Architectural asphalt shingles offer good wind resistance and longevity. Three-tab asphalt shingles are a more economical choice for basic coverage. Metal roofing provides superior durability against harsh New England weather.

Will homeowners insurance cover roof repair in Massachusetts?

Homeowners insurance in Massachusetts may cover roof repair if the damage is caused by a covered event like storms or wind. Damage from general wear and tear or lack of maintenance is typically not covered. It's recommended to review your policy or contact your insurance provider for specifics.

What are common roof shingle types in Massachusetts?

Common roof shingle types in Massachusetts include architectural asphalt shingles, offering enhanced durability against New England weather, and standard three-tab asphalt shingles. Metal roofing is also a popular choice for its resilience against snow, ice, and wind common in the state.
